Pierce/Atlantic Emergency Solutions Presentation

Print RSS Facebook Twitter RSS

By Fire / Rescue Lieutenant Matt Stansbury
January 18, 2012

Prior to the Reese and Community Vol. Fire Company monthly membership meeting on Tuesday, January 17th, 2012, Atlantic Emergency Solutions Salesman Bob Rosensteel presented 2012 President and New Engine Committee Co-Chairmen Doc Stone, Co-Chairman Matt Knight, 2011 Chief Jerry Dayton, and Committee Member and current Assistant Chief James Love with a framed picture of our new Engine 91 in front of the Pierce Manufacturing Plant in Appleton, Wisconsin. The Reese and Community Vol. Fire Company will proudly display this picture in our fire station. We look forward to our continued partnership and working with Pierce Manufacturing and Atlantic Emergency Solutions in the future.

Also, on behalf of the membership of the Reese and Community Vol. Fire Company, Assistant Chief James Love presented "Rosie" (Bob Rosensteel) with a "cheese head" style fire helmet with the names of the New Engine Committee Members written on it. Pierce Manufacturing is located in Wisconsin and the "cheese head" is synonymous with that region. Also presented were 2 pictures of "Rosie" with the new Engine 91 in front of the Pierce Factory. We look forward to hopefully working with "Rosie" again in the future.

Thanks to Pierce, Atlantic Emergency Solutions and all the members of Reese who worked tirelessly on the New Engine project. Look for the new Engine 91 coming down a street near you!
